def _clean_env_value(value: str) -> str:
"""
Clean environment variable value by removing comments and whitespace.
Args:
value: Raw environment variable value
Returns:
Cleaned value with comments and extra whitespace removed
"""
if not value:
return value
# Remove inline comments (anything after #)
if '#' in value:
value = value.split('#')[0]
# Strip whitespace
return value.strip()
def _get_env_int(key: str, default: str) -> int:
"""
Safely get an integer environment variable.
Args:
key: Environment variable key
default: Default value as string
Returns:
Integer value
Raises:
ValueError: If the value cannot be converted to int
"""
raw_value = os.getenv(key, default)
clean_value = _clean_env_value(raw_value)
try:
return int(clean_value)
except ValueError as e:
raise ValueError(f"Invalid integer value for {key}: '{raw_value}' (cleaned: '{clean_value}')") from e
def _get_env_float(key: str, default: str) -> float:
"""
Safely get a float environment variable.
Args:
key: Environment variable key
default: Default value as string
Returns:
Float value
Raises:
ValueError: If the value cannot be converted to float
"""
raw_value = os.getenv(key, default)
clean_value = _clean_env_value(raw_value)
try:
return float(clean_value)
except ValueError as e:
raise ValueError(f"Invalid float value for {key}: '{raw_value}' (cleaned: '{clean_value}')") from e
def _get_env_str(key: str, default: str) -> str:
"""
Safely get a string environment variable.
Args:
key: Environment variable key
default: Default value
Returns:
Cleaned string value
"""
raw_value = os.getenv(key, default)
return _clean_env_value(raw_value)
